Disseminate Your Awesome Cover Songs Legally

Cover songs can be a fantastic way to express your musical talent and connect with fans. But it's crucial to distribute them legally to avoid any difficulties.

The first step is to secure the necessary licenses from the original songwriters. This typically involves contacting the publishing company that owns the copyright. Once you have permission, you can then publish your cover songs to various sites like Spotify, YouTube, or SoundCloud. Be sure to precisely acknowledge the original artist and composer in all your outreach efforts. By following these steps, you can legally release your stunning cover songs and build a loyal fan base while respecting the rights of the original creators.

Utilizing a Song: Legal Landscape

When delving into the world of music creation, many artists find themselves drawn towards the concept of covering existing songs. While it can be a rewarding experience to put your own twist on a beloved track, it's essential to grasp the legal regulations surrounding this practice. Copyright law bestows exclusive rights to songwriters and publishers, signifying that reproducing or rendering a copyrighted work without permission can result in legal repercussions.
